Product Description
Product Overview
The 35V35A 1C22R is a Vickers by Danfoss V Series fixed-displacement industrial vane pump based on the 35V frame.
Danfoss describes its Vickers industrial vane-pump portfolio as compact, quiet and serviceable, with solutions for industrial and mobile hydraulic applications. The V Series uses an intra-vane cartridge design and is available in single, double and thru-drive configurations.
The exact 35V35A 1C22R configuration is directly identified in Danfoss PowerSource:
- 35: Series designation
- V: Vane pump
- 35: 35 GPM ring capacity
- A: 4-bolt flange inlet and outlet
- 1: 1-5/16-in square-key straight shaft
- C: Outlet inline with inlet
- 22: Design No. 22
- R: Clockwise rotation viewed from the shaft end.
Danfoss’s official V Series technical information specifies the 35V35 displacement as 112 cm³/rev (6.83 in³/rev). The applicable 35V rating reaches 172 bar (2500 psi) with a maximum speed of 1800 r/min.
For aftermarket replacement, the complete model code should be matched rather than only the 35V35 designation. Technical Specifications
Primary Model: 35V35A 1C22R
- Brand: Vickers by Danfoss
- Series: V Series
- Model: 35V35A 1C22R
- Pump Type: Fixed-displacement vane pump
- Frame Size: 35V
- Ring Capacity: 35 GPM
- Geometric Displacement: 112 cm³/rev
- Control: Fixed displacement
- Maximum Speed: 1800 r/min
- Maximum Working Pressure: 172 bar (2500 psi)
- Shaft: 1 — 1-5/16-in square-key shaft
- Rotation: R — clockwise, viewed from shaft end
- Port Connection: A — 4-bolt flange inlet and outlet
- Outlet Position: C — outlet inline with inlet
- Design: 22
- Mounting: Flange mounting
- Housing Material: Cast iron, as identified in published 35V product records.
- Product Height: 152.4 mm (6.00 in)
- Product Length: 258.1 mm (10.16 in)
- Product Width: 212.9 mm (8.38 in)
- Flange System: SAE 4-bolt flange; the official installation documentation identifies the applicable 35V FL-10 / FL-16 flange series.
- Weight: Not individually displayed in the currently retrieved official PowerSource record for 35V35A 1C22R; therefore no unsupported weight is stated.
- Peak Pressure: The official material uses maximum working pressure rather than a separate universal peak-pressure value for this configuration. The published working-pressure rating is 172 bar.
Other 35V Displacements
The official V Series technical information defines the following 35V displacement codes:
- 35V25: 81 cm³/rev
- 35V30: 97 cm³/rev
- 35V35: 112 cm³/rev
- 35V38: 121 cm³/rev
Therefore, the supplied 35V25A, 35V35A and 35V38A designations represent different displacements within the same 35V frame family.

Key Technical Advantages
1. Intra-Vane Cartridge Architecture
The Vickers by Danfoss V Series uses an intra-vane cartridge design, which Danfoss associates with the family’s quiet operation, serviceability and long operating life.
From an engineering perspective, the cartridge architecture allows the primary working components to be serviced as an integrated unit, supporting efficient maintenance and performance restoration.
2. High 112 cm³/rev Displacement
The 35V35A 1C22R provides a published geometric displacement of 112 cm³/rev.
At 1800 r/min, the theoretical displacement flow is:
112 × 1800 / 1000 = 201.6 L/min
Therefore, the theoretical geometric flow is approximately 201.6 L/min before accounting for volumetric losses.
Actual delivered flow varies with pressure, viscosity, temperature, speed and volumetric efficiency, so this value should not be treated as a universal guaranteed output.
3. Low-Noise Flow Characteristics
Danfoss specifies a 12-vane system for the V Series and states that it generates low-amplitude flow pulsations, contributing to lower overall system noise.
This is particularly valuable in:
- Machine tools
- Presses
- Injection molding machinery
- Hydraulic power units
where pump-generated pulsation and acoustic noise can affect the machine environment.
4. Hydraulic Balancing
The V Series uses hydraulic balancing to reduce internally generated hydraulic loading on the shaft and bearings. Danfoss lists long operating life and reliability as key characteristics of the V Series.
5. SAE 4-Bolt Flange Interface
The 35V35A 1C22R uses SAE 4-bolt flange inlet and outlet connections. This provides a defined industrial mounting interface and supports rigid hydraulic piping arrangements.
6. Complete Model Code Supports Retrofit Accuracy
For 35V35A 1C22R:
1 + C + 22 + R
define important mechanical configuration elements including shaft, outlet position, design and rotation.
In particular:
C = outlet inline with inlet
This can be critical during retrofit because two pumps with identical displacement may still be mechanically incompatible if shaft or port orientation differs.
7. Service-Friendly Cartridge Concept
The V Series cartridge architecture supports targeted maintenance and is one reason Danfoss emphasizes serviceability as a core product characteristic.

Expert Maintenance Tips
1. Verify the Complete Model Number
Before installation, verify:
35V35A + 1 + C + 22 + R
Pay particular attention to:
Shaft → Outlet Position → Design → Rotation
Danfoss PowerSource directly defines these configuration elements in the product record.
2. Confirm Rotation
R = clockwise rotation, viewed from the shaft end.
Verify motor and pump rotation before commissioning.
3. Protect the Inlet Circuit
For a 112 cm³/rev pump, inlet flow requirements are substantial. Poor suction conditions can increase:
- Cavitation risk
- Noise
- Flow instability
- Internal wear
- Temperature rise
The suction circuit should therefore minimize unnecessary restriction, sharp bends and undersized piping.
4. Do Not Treat 172 Bar as a Universal Continuous Design Target
The published 172 bar value represents the applicable maximum working-pressure rating. Actual continuous operation should be evaluated together with fluid condition, speed, temperature and duty cycle.
5. Maintain Drive Alignment
Check:
- Motor-to-pump concentricity
- Coupling alignment
- Key/keyway fit
- Axial movement
- Mounting-face condition
Misalignment can impose excessive loads on the shaft, bearings and shaft seal.
6. Maintain Hydraulic Cleanliness
Danfoss publishes recommended contamination levels for Vickers hydraulic components. Clean fluid and effective filtration are important for protecting vane, rotor and internal working surfaces.
7. Commission Progressively
After installation, use:
Prime → No-Load Rotation → Flow Check → Pressure Build-Up → Rated Load
Monitor noise, vibration, flow, oil temperature, shaft-seal condition and flange leakage.
